What Exactly Does An Orthodontist Do?


An orthodontist is a little different compared to a dentist. Where a dentist cleans your teeth and maintains your gums, an orthodontist will come in and structural fix your jawline and position your teeth in the proper form. One good example of what an orthodontist does is let’s say you have crooked teeth, an orthodontist will use methods such as braces to structurally put them back in place. What Should You Consider


When you are thinking of getting a treatment done to your teeth, there are a few great examples of what you can look for to make the decision easier. If you have any of the following problems with your mouth, considering going to an orthodontist will be a wise decision.


• Two Many Teeth: When you have too many teeth in your mouth, it is called crowding. When this happens your dental line is adjusted causing for some teeth to potentially break or become crooked.


• Under or Overbites: When you have an overbite, your teeth sometimes look like “buck teeth”. And with an under bite, your facial structure may look similar to a bulldog. When this happens, nightly teeth grinding is possible as well as crooked and under or overdeveloped jawlines.


• Miss Lined Teeth: When your teeth are developed as a child, they should come in straight and natural. However, some people’s teeth are not lined up, and an orthodontist is great at getting them adjusted.
